Mary Elizabeth THOMSER

  • Born: 14 Dec 1871, Williamsburg, Kings, NY, USA
  • Marriage (1): Francis Joseph Xavier REISS about 1890
  • Died: 29 Jan 1903, Brooklyn, Kings, NY, USA
  • Buried: 1 Feb 1903, Brooklyn, Kings, NY, USA

bullet  General Notes:

On the certificates of baptism for her three children, Mary has the first name "Maria." However, her surname is variously spelled as Thompson, Tompser, and Tromser. A wooden box in the possession of her grandson, Thomas, spelled out the name as "Thomser." The Social Security Application of her son Louis Frank also lists her surname as Thomser.

The sponsors at the baptism of Louis Francis were Louis and Lena "Tromser." At the baptism of Charles, Charles and Philomena Pabst were the sponsors. The sponsors for Mae were listed as F.X. and Maria E. Reiss.

The 1900 Federal census lists the Frank Reiss family at 168 Leonard Street (one of eight families at that site). According to the record, Frank and Mary had been married for 9 years in June 1900. The 1900 Census states that Mary's father was born in France and her mother in New York. The 1920 census record for Mary's daughter, Mae, states that Mae's mother was born in France and spoke French.

The Death Certificate for Mary Elizabeth Reiss indicates that she died on Jan. 29, 1903 at the age of 31. She is identified as being born in the US, with her parents both born in Germany. The certificate states that she died at 103 Ten Eyck Street, which is identified as a tenement. This building is near both the the Hope Street address listed as the Reiss residence in 1894 and the Leonard St. residence in1900. Causes of her death are listed as asthenia (weakness/debility) and Phthisis Pulmonalis (tuberculosis/consumption) . (Her mother, Appolonia Koferl Thomser, died at age 28 from the latter affliction.) Mary was buried at Holy Trinity Cemetery on February 1, 1903. The doctor is listed as John Ho?is, 79 Penn Street, Bklyn. He treated her from December 15, 1902 to January 28, 1903. (Above medical information (spellings and definitions) are from Stedman's Medical Dictionary, 1933.)

A visit was made to Most Holy Trinity Cemetery on June 4, 2000. It was discovered that there is no marker on Mary's grave (Block 11, Row 1, #27). The location was identified through a receipt for payment of plot rent signed by L.F. Reiss in 1930. A geranium was placed on the gravesite.

According to Rosemary Reiss, granddaughter, Mary dropped dead while baking a cake.

Mary married Francis Joseph Xavier REISS, son of Emmerich Josef REISS and Mary Elizabeth RAUCH, about 1890. (Francis Joseph Xavier REISS was born on 31 Jan 1866 in New York, USA and died on 6 Mar 1931 in Forest Hills, Queens, NY, USA.)
